[0013]A detailed explanation of a polyurethane coating process is set forth in U.S. Pat. No. 7,638,008, which is incorporated herein in its entirety. The roller coating process of this patent and related improvements as described in U.S. Ser. No. 15 / 782,265, is advantageously used in the manufacture of lightweight carpet products.
[0014]FIG. 1 depicts a sectional view of a loop pile carpet tile 40 with looped bights of yarn 41 penetrating a backing material 42, bound in position with a polyurethane adhesive layer 43, and an attached secondary backing of 44. The carpet density can be substantially less than 3000, or less than 2500, or even less than 2000. Carpet density is calculated using the following formula:
Carpet face weight×36 / carpet pile height=density, measured in ounces per cubic yard
